6. Artificial Intelligence and Analytics

LADFAH Services may include artificial intelligence, machine learning, predictive analytics, computer vision, document intelligence, engineering analytics, or automated recommendation capabilities.

Users must apply appropriate professional judgment. AI-generated or algorithmically generated outputs should not automatically replace qualified engineering judgment, professional safety assessments, regulatory requirements, operational procedures, required human approvals, equipment manufacturer requirements, or emergency-response procedures.

7. Safety-Critical and Operational Use

Certain LADFAH solutions may support drilling, production, asset management, HSE, maintenance, inspection, environmental, emergency-response, or other industrial operations.

Unless explicitly agreed otherwise, LADFAH Services should not be treated as the sole control mechanism for safety-critical equipment or processes. Customers and users remain responsible for maintaining appropriate operational controls, safety systems, alarms, emergency systems, engineering verification, human oversight, and regulatory compliance.
